main responsibilities
what will you be doing?
provide first and second level support/ management for it related queries, adhering to agreed business service levels.
recognise and escalate incident trends to enable prompt action from incident & problem management as appropriate.
achieve high levels of accuracy in capturing incident details on service management tools in accordance with team processes and procedures.
manage 2nd line support queue and ensure ticket allocation, vetting and resolution is carried out in accordance with documented guidelines.
pro-actively document and fill gaps in processes, knowledge and tools, and make recommendations for improvement. implement where possible.
provide technical guidance and input to all teams within service operations and act as project resource when requested
assist with other areas of service operations support workload as instructed by service operations kpi's.
manage, maintain and improve service operations associated services.
the ideal candidate
do you have the following skills and experience?
essential
comprehensive knowledge of windows desktop and server operating systems, ms exchange online and office productivity suite of applications / office 365 applications.
good working knowledge of mobile handheld technologies; specifically, apple ios devices
understanding of printing devices and services such as hp, canon, safecom pull print
excellent technical skills gained with relevant experience in a service support function, including supporting bespoke software applications.
self-starter requiring little supervision to achieve productivity and service targets.
highly effective communicator with outstanding customer service skills and the ability to influence outside own team.
outstanding problem-solving skills.
highly collaborative, pro-actively taking the initiative to support colleagues and fill knowledge and process gaps.
committed to personal development and self-improvement.
role model exceptional customer service to both internal and external customers.
desirable
itil foundation
microsoft/oracle accredited in relevant disciplines
good working knowledge of networking and protocols
understanding of other service management disciplines (e.g., configuration, change, problem, operations, capacity, availability, performance etc.)
understanding of voice over ip telephony and contact centre systems.
experience of developing tools and utilities using ms powershell
good network and infrastructure knowledge
ability to adapt readily to changing work and responsibilities
